-
公开(公告)号:US10740270B2
公开(公告)日:2020-08-11
申请号:US15578521
申请日:2015-06-26
Applicant: HEWLETT PACKARD ENTERPRISE DEVELOPMENT LP
Inventor: Kevin G. Depew , Vincent Nguyen , Scott P. Faasse , Robert E. Van Cleve
Abstract: Example implementations relate to a self-tune controller. For example, the self-tune controller may poll, via an out-of-band data stream, low-level operation information about a processor or a bus of a computing system under a present workload. At least some of the low-level operation information may be descriptive of a nature of traffic on the bus. The self-tune controller may program, via an out-of-band control signal, a setting of the computing system for the present workload based on the low-level operation information.
-
公开(公告)号:US20210232691A1
公开(公告)日:2021-07-29
申请号:US16774219
申请日:2020-01-28
Applicant: HEWLETT PACKARD ENTERPRISE DEVELOPMENT LP
Inventor: Travis D. Bishop , Kevin G. Depew
Abstract: A technique includes, in a first phase of a secure boot of a computer system, executing boot code of the computer system to access a first version of a secure boot key database to authenticate driver code. The first version of the secure boot key database stores a key corresponding to a plurality of drivers. The technique includes executing the boot code to automatically prepare the secure boot key database for a second phase of the secure boot in which operating system bootloader code is executed. Preparing for the second phase includes executing the boot code to automatically replace the first version of the secure boot key database with a second version of the secure boot key database, and the second version of the secure boot key database stores a key, which corresponds to the operating system bootloader code. The technique includes in the second phase of the secure boot, executing the boot code to access the secure boot key database to authenticate the operating system bootloader code.
-
公开(公告)号:US20190236279A1
公开(公告)日:2019-08-01
申请号:US15884747
申请日:2018-01-31
Applicant: HEWLETT PACKARD ENTERPRISE DEVELOPMENT LP
Inventor: Kevin G. Depew , Darrell R. Haskell , John S. Harsany
CPC classification number: G06F21/575 , G06F9/44505 , G06F2221/034
Abstract: Examples disclosed herein relate to an approach to take a startup inventory of a computing including multiple startup components, where the startup inventory includes information about the at least one processing element, at least one memory device, a system board, and a bus device on a bus. The startup inventory is compared to a stored inventory taken when the computing device was put into a first mode to determine whether the startup inventory and the stored inventory match. A security action is performed in response to the comparison.
-
公开(公告)号:US11106798B2
公开(公告)日:2021-08-31
申请号:US16774219
申请日:2020-01-28
Applicant: HEWLETT PACKARD ENTERPRISE DEVELOPMENT LP
Inventor: Travis D. Bishop , Kevin G. Depew
Abstract: A technique includes, in a first phase of a secure boot of a computer system, executing boot code of the computer system to access a first version of a secure boot key database to authenticate driver code. The first version of the secure boot key database stores a key corresponding to a plurality of drivers. The technique includes executing the boot code to automatically prepare the secure boot key database for a second phase of the secure boot in which operating system bootloader code is executed. Preparing for the second phase includes executing the boot code to automatically replace the first version of the secure boot key database with a second version of the secure boot key database, and the second version of the secure boot key database stores a key, which corresponds to the operating system bootloader code. The technique includes in the second phase of the secure boot, executing the boot code to access the secure boot key database to authenticate the operating system bootloader code.
-
公开(公告)号:US20190278708A1
公开(公告)日:2019-09-12
申请号:US16426722
申请日:2019-05-30
Applicant: HEWLETT PACKARD ENTERPRISE DEVELOPMENT LP
Inventor: Paul Dennis Stultz , James T. Bodner , Kevin G. Depew
IPC: G06F12/06 , G06F11/16 , G06F9/4401 , G06F9/445
Abstract: A method for configuring a computer system memory, includes powering on the computer system; retrieving options for initializing the computer system; assigning to a first segment of the memory a first pre-defined setting; assigning to a second segment of the memory a second pre-defined setting; and booting the computer system.
-
公开(公告)号:US20180165238A1
公开(公告)日:2018-06-14
申请号:US15578521
申请日:2015-06-26
Applicant: HEWLETT PACKARD ENTERPRISE DEVELOPMENT LP
Inventor: Kevin G. Depew , Vincent Nguyen , Scott P. Faasse , Robert E. Van Cleve
Abstract: Example implementations relate to a self-tune controller. For example, the self-tune controller may poll, via an out-of-band data stream, low-level operation information about a processor or a bus of a computing system under a present workload. At least some of the low-level operation information may be descriptive of a nature of traffic on the bus. The self-tune controller may program, via an out-of-band control signal, a setting of the computing system for the present workload based on the low-level operation information.
-
公开(公告)号:US11954029B2
公开(公告)日:2024-04-09
申请号:US18176661
申请日:2023-03-01
Applicant: Hewlett Packard Enterprise Development LP
Inventor: Paul Dennis Stultz , James T. Bodner , Kevin G. Depew
CPC classification number: G06F12/0646 , G06F9/4406 , G06F9/4411 , G06F9/44505 , G06F11/1666 , G06F12/0653 , G06F11/20 , G06F12/023 , G06F2201/845 , G06F2212/1016 , Y02D10/00
Abstract: A method for configuring a computer system memory, includes powering on the computer system; retrieving options for initializing the computer system; assigning to a first segment of the memory a first pre-defined setting; assigning to a second segment of the memory a second pre-defined setting; and booting the computer system.
-
-
-
-
-
-